Related occupations
Explore related occupations in the commercial cleaner sector.
Housekeeper
A Housekeeper is responsible for cleaning and maintaining guest rooms in hotels, ensuring high standards of service and attention to detail.
Cleaner
A Cleaner performs cleaning tasks in various settings, ensuring attention to detail and strong customer service while managing schedules.
Executive Housekeeper
An Executive Housekeeper supervises housekeeping services, managing staff, schedules, and training while ensuring high standards of customer service.
Cleaning Supervisor
A Cleaning Supervisor manages a cleaning team, ensures standards are met, schedules jobs, and prioritises customer service while solving issues.
Laundry Worker
A Laundry Worker sorts, washes, and finishes laundry for clients, handling stains and repairs while ensuring excellent customer service and teamwork.
Dry Cleaner
A Dry Cleaner uses specialised techniques to clean garments and fabric products, ensuring attention to detail and strong customer service skills.
More about commercial cleaner courses in New South Wales
If you're seeking to establish a rewarding career in the cleaning industry, exploring the various Commercial Cleaner courses in New South Wales is an excellent place to start. With a diverse range of courses designed to cater to both beginners and experienced professionals, you can choose a learning pathway that suits your current skill level and career aspirations. From entry-level qualifications to advanced training, there’s something for everyone in this flourishing sector.
For those new to the field, there are six beginner courses available that will equip you with essential skills and knowledge. The Certificate III in Cleaning Operations CPP30321 is a popular choice for individuals looking to gain hands-on experience in various cleaning settings. Additional beginner options such as the Inspect and Clean Machinery, Tools and Equipment to Preserve Biosecurity AHCBIO203 and the Certificate I in Access to Vocational Pathways FSK10119 support learners in forging a strong foundation for their careers.
Experienced learners seeking to enhance their qualifications can consider the advanced course offerings available, such as the Certificate IV in Cleaning CPP40421. This course is tailored for individuals who already possess some experience and are looking to advance their careers within the commercial cleaning industry. By gaining additional skills and knowledge, you’ll be better equipped to take on supervisory roles or specialise in areas such as hygiene management.
The training providers listed for each of these Commercial Cleaner courses in New South Wales are either Registered Training Organisations (RTOs) or recognised industry bodies, ensuring that your education meets industry standards. The programs are designed to provide real-world applications, helping you to develop the confidence and practical skills needed in the workplace.
